Mechanics of the Modern Swing

Core Principles

The Mike Young Baseball approach starts with a compact swing path that keeps the hands inside the ball. Players are taught to maintain a stable lower body while the upper body rotates efficiently, reducing energy leaks and improving barrel control.

Stride length and timing are calibrated to each hitter’s frame, allowing a balanced load and a strong forward move. Emphasis on keeping the top hand quiet helps hitters stay palm up through impact, which supports consistent line drives.

Training Tools and Technology

Data Driven Feedback

Modern training sessions often include bat speed sensors, launch monitors, and high speed video to provide objective feedback. These tools help players and coaches see the direct impact of mechanical adjustments on exit velocity and launch angle.

By correlating swing metrics with ball flight outcomes, hitters can prioritize changes that meaningfully improve performance in game like situations.

Drill Progression Structure

Drills are sequenced from simplified constraints to more complex scenarios. This progression helps players internalize movements before adding unpredictability, which mirrors the cognitive demands of live pitching.

Performance and Offseason Development

Strength and Mobility Integration

Offseason programming blends strength training with mobility work, targeting the hips, core, and shoulder complex. Players learn to transfer force from the ground through their core and into the swing, supporting sustainable velocity gains.

In season plans focus on maintenance, using lower volume, higher intensity sessions to preserve gains without impeding recovery between games.

Mental Skills and Game Execution

Pre Pitch Routine and Decision Making

A consistent pre pitch routine helps hitters narrow attention, recognize pitcher tendencies, and commit to a plan. This structured approach reduces hesitation and supports aggressive decision making with two strikes.

Players are encouraged to review at bat data, not just outcomes, to identify mechanical and approach patterns that can be adjusted in subsequent games.

Action Plan for Players and Families

  • Assess current swing mechanics with baseline video and, if possible, bat speed data.
  • Set specific, measurable goals such as bat speed, contact percentage, or exit velocity targets.
  • Follow a structured drill progression that moves from simplified to game realistic scenarios.
  • Integrate strength and mobility work that supports efficient force transfer through the kinetic chain.
  • Track progress on a regular schedule using objective metrics and video review to stay motivated.
  • Use pre pitch routines and decision training to improve plate discipline under pressure.
  • Communicate regularly with coaches to align training load and avoid overuse or burnout.
